Catalog description

This course will cover three modalities. Acting/Scene Study: Realism will provide a fundamental understanding of Stanislavski-based acting within the realistic style, developing: a working understanding of a five-week rehearsal process; a system of text analysis based upon events and cause-and-effect; beginning the work of integrating vocal and physical technique into each individual student’s acting method. Voice and Speech I will provide the basis of the actor’s three years of vocal training, gaining an understanding of the actor’s personal vocal blocks as they relate to how the breath resides in the body. Contact Improvisation will investigate improvisation movement through physical contact.
